THAI INSPIRED SPICY CURRY BUTTERNUT SQUASH SOUP



Thai Inspired Spicy Curry Butternut Squash Soup image

Love Thai flavors and I felt they would be a perfect match to play off the richness of a butternut squash soup. Curry, coconut, spicy are a wonderful to balance the richness of the squash. The first time I made it was kind of an accident. I was trying to make the traditional soup but when I tasted it lacked something. I looked to see how I could punch up the flavor. First I added the curry, I had some leftover red curry paste I made, added coconut milk and I felt I had something special. Like many soups and stews the flavor is better the following day. Enjoy!

Time 1h40m

Yield 12

Number Of Ingredients 14

2 tablespoons olive oil
2 chili moritas, or more to taste
1 large white onion, diced
5 carrots, peeled and diced
2 stalks celery, diced
2 cloves garlic
salt and ground black pepper to taste
2 tablespoons red curry paste, or to taste
1 tablespoon smoked paprika
1 large butternut squash - peeled, seeded, and diced
1 quart chicken stock
1 quart water
1 (14 ounce) can coconut milk
2 bay leaves

Steps:

  • Heat a large heavy-bottom pot over medium-high heat; add olive oil. Cook and stir chili moritas in the hot oil until chili moritas are puffed and softened, 3 to 5 minutes. Stir onion, carrots, celery, garlic, salt, and pepper into chili moritas and cook until onion is translucent, 10 to 15 minutes.
  • Stir curry paste and paprika into chili-onion mixture until coated. Add butternut squash; cook and stir until squash is lightly browned, about 5 minutes. Pour chicken stock, water, and coconut milk into squash mixture; add bay leaves. Bring mixture to a boil, reduce heat, and simmer until squash is softened, about 1 hour.
  • Pour squash mixture into a blender no more than half full. Cover and hold lid down; pulse a few times before leaving on to blend. Puree in batches until smooth.

SPICY BUTTERNUT SQUASH AND CARROT SOUP



Spicy Butternut Squash and Carrot Soup image

This butternut squash and carrot soup is by far one of the best soups I've made and I constantly find myself making it over and over again! It's savory and goes great with toasted bread.

Time 45m

Yield 4

Number Of Ingredients 12

1 medium butternut squash, peeled and cut into 2-inch cubes
3 carrots, peeled and cut into thirds
2 tablespoons olive oil, divided
1 tablespoon curry powder
2 teaspoons chili powder
2 teaspoons coarsely ground black pepper
1 pinch salt
½ medium yellow onion, chopped
1 habanero pepper, seeded and chopped, or more to taste
4 cloves garlic, diced
4 cups water, or more to taste
2 cubes chicken bouillon

Steps:

  • Preheat the oven to 425 degrees F (220 degrees C).
  • Place squash and carrots in a bowl. Drizzle with 1 tablespoon olive oil and add curry powder, chili powder, pepper, and salt. Place on a rimmed baking sheet.
  • Roast in the preheated oven until vegetables are soft, about 20 minutes.
  • Meanwhile, place onion, habanero pepper, and garlic in a pot with remaining olive oil and saute over medium heat until soft and fragrant, 5 to 7 minutes. Add water and bouillon, increase heat to medium-high, and bring to a boil. Stir in roasted squash and carrots, reduce heat, and let simmer for 10 to 15 minutes.
  • Transfer carefully to an electric blender or food processor, in batches if necessary, and blend until smooth.

SPICY ROASTED BUTTERNUT SQUASH, PEAR, AND BACON SOUP



Spicy Roasted Butternut Squash, Pear, and Bacon Soup image

Fall spices and a hint of chipotle combined with the sweetness of butternut squash and pears come together with Swanson® Chicken Broth to create a warming puree.

Time 1h40m

Yield 8

Number Of Ingredients 14

1 (3 pound) butternut squash - peeled, seeded, and cubed
1 pinch salt and ground black pepper to taste
1 tablespoon olive oil
8 strips maple-flavored bacon, chopped
1 large white onion, chopped
2 medium pear (approx 2-1/2 per lb)s red pears - peeled, seeded, and chopped
2 cloves fresh garlic, minced
1 tablespoon chopped fresh rosemary
1 teaspoon dried thyme
½ teaspoon ground nutmeg
½ teaspoon ground cinnamon
¼ teaspoon ground dried chipotle pepper
3 cups Swanson® Chicken Broth
1 teaspoon sour cream for garnish

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 375 degrees F (190 degrees C). Line a large baking sheet with aluminum foil.
  • Place squash in a large bowl; drizzle with olive oil and toss to coat. Spread the squash in a single layer on prepared baking sheet. Season with salt and pepper.
  • Roast squash in prepared oven for 20 minutes; turn. Continue roasting until softened, 10 to 20 minutes more.
  • Place the chopped bacon into a heavy pot and cook over medium-high heat, stirring occasionally, until brown and crisp, about 8 minutes. Remove bacon with a slotted spoon and transfer to a paper towel-lined plate to drain. Reserve the bacon drippings.
  • Place the pot over medium heat; add the onion, pears, garlic, rosemary, and thyme and cook in the bacon drippings until onions and pears are soft, 3 to 5 minutes. Add the roasted squash and cook another 5 minutes. Add Swanson® Chicken Broth, nutmeg, cinnamon, and chipotle pepper; simmer on medium-low until ingredients are very soft and flavors have combined, about 10 minutes.
  • Puree the soup in a blender or food processor in small batches.
  • Ladle soup into serving bowls and garnish with crumbled bacon and a generous dollop of sour cream. Enjoy!

BUTTERNUT SQUASH AND SPICY SAUSAGE SOUP



Butternut Squash and Spicy Sausage Soup image

Fall is my favorite time of year because I can make this soup. It's filling and delicious! There are many ways to customize the ingredients to suit your tastes. Sometimes I used flavored rice, depending on what I have on hand. Also, add more or less chicken broth to make the soup's thickness fit your liking.

Time 1h18m

Yield 8

Number Of Ingredients 12

2 cups water
½ cup long grain white rice
1 unpeeled butternut squash, halved and seeded
1 tablespoon olive oil
1 large yellow onion, chopped
1 ¼ pounds spicy turkey sausage, casings removed
1 cup frozen corn
2 (13.75 ounce) cans chicken broth
salt to taste
1 tablespoon ground black pepper, or to taste
salt, to taste
½ cup heavy cream

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 375 degrees F (190 degrees C). Pour 1 cup of water into 9x13 baking dish.
  • Place the butternut squash into the prepared baking dish, cut side down.
  • Bake in preheated oven until squash is easily pierced with a fork, about 45 minutes.
  • Meanwhile, place the rice and remaining 1 cup of water into a saucepan. Bring to a boil, uncovered, over medium-high heat. Reduce heat to low, cover, and simmer until water is absorbed and rice is fluffy, about 20 minutes. Remove from the heat and fluff with a fork.
  • Heat the olive oil in a large soup pot over medium-high heat. Stir in the onion, and cook until tender and transparent, about 5 minutes. Mix in the turkey sausage; cook until crumbly and evenly browned. Drain any excess fat. Stir in the cooked rice and corn.
  • Scoop out cooked squash and place in a blender or bowl of a food processor. Discard squash peels. Pour chicken broth into the blender or bowl of a food processor with the squash. Blend until smooth, about 1 minute.
  • Stir squash mixture into the sausage mixture until well blended. Season with pepper, and salt to taste. If desired, stir in the heavy cream. Simmer soup over medium heat until heated through, about 15 minutes, but do not boil.

INSTANT POT® SPICY BUTTERNUT SQUASH SOUP



Instant Pot® Spicy Butternut Squash Soup image

This quick and easy butternut squash soup is so flavorful with ginger and brown sugar; and it only takes a few minutes in your Instant Pot®!

Time 1h

Yield 6

Number Of Ingredients 11

1 tablespoon olive oil
1 onion, diced
2 cloves garlic
1 pound butternut squash - peeled, seeded, and cut into 1-inch pieces
5 cups vegetable broth
1 tablespoon brown sugar
1 teaspoon salt
½ teaspoon ground black pepper
½ teaspoon ground ginger
½ teaspoon curry powder
1 cup heavy whipping cream

Steps:

  • Turn on a multi-functional pressure cooker (such as Instant Pot®) and select Saute function. Heat olive oil and add onion; cook until translucent, about 7 minutes. Add garlic and cook for 1 minute more.
  • Combine butternut squash, vegetable broth, brown sugar, salt, ground black pepper, ginger, and curry powder in the pot. Close and lock the lid. Select high pressure according to manufacturer's instructions; set timer for 10 minutes. Allow 10 to 15 minutes for pressure to build.
  • Release pressure carefully using the quick-release method according to manufacturer's instructions, about 5 minutes. Unlock and remove lid. Blend with an immersion blender until creamy.
  • Stir in heavy whipping cream.

SOUP ROASTED BUTTERNUT SQUASH SOUP WITH SPICY SEEDS



Soup Roasted Butternut Squash Soup With Spicy Seeds image

Derek Clayton, the corporate chef at Michael Symon's Lola in Cleveland, brings out the squash's inherent sweetness with maple syrup.

Time 1h10m

Yield 6 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 17

1 butternut squash (about 3 pounds)
olive oil
salt
1 teaspoon butter, melted
2 pinches cayenne pepper
1 pinch ground cinnamon
vegetable oil
2 yellow onions, finely chopped (about 2 cups)
2 medium carrots, chopped (about 1 cup)
2 medium celery ribs, chopped (about1/2 cup)
1/2 jalapeno, seeded and finely chopped (optional)
1/4 cup maple syrup
4 cups chicken stock
1/2 cup heavy cream (optional)
cider vinegar
1 granny smith apple, thinly sliced into matchsticks
1/2 cup cilantro leaf

Steps:

  • 1. Preheat the oven to 400°. Slice the squash in half lengthwise, scoop out the seeds and fibrous pulp and separate the seeds from the stringy pulp. Reserve the seeds. Use a sharp knife to score the neck portion of the squash several times, then rub the flesh with olive oil and season with salt. Roast the squash cut side down on a baking sheet until tender and lightly caramelized, about 1 hour.
  • 2. In a colander, rinse the reserved seeds and dry with paper towels. Place on a sheet pan and toast in the oven for 5 minutes, until golden and fragrant. In a small bowl, whisk together the melted butter, cayenne pepper, cinnamon and a large pinch of salt. Toss the seeds in the mixture and set aside.
  • 3. In a medium stockpot set over medium heat, heat about a tablespoon of vegetable oil. Add the onions, carrots, celery and jalapeño, if using, and cook, stirring often, until tender, about 10 minutes. Add the maple syrup and cook, stirring frequently, until the syrup is reduced by two-thirds, about 5 minutes. Remove the stockpot from the heat and set aside.
  • 4. When the squash is done, remove it from the oven and allow it to cool briefly. Remove the squash flesh from the skin and mix it into stockpot with the onion and carrot mixture. Return the stockpot to the stove. Turn the heat to medium, add the chicken stock and cream, bring to a simmer and cook for 10 minutes. Carefully transfer the soup to a blender and blend until smooth OR Use a immersible blender which is much easier in the cooker, without the chance of spilling. Season with the cider vinegar and salt. Serve soup hot with apple, cilantro and toasted seeds.

GINGERED BUTTERNUT SQUASH SOUP WITH SPICY PECAN CREAM

Yield 12

Number Of Ingredients 14

2 large butternut squash (5 1/2 pounds), halved lengthwise and seeded
1 tablespoon extra-virgin olive oil
3/4 cup pecans (2 ounces)
2 tablespoons unsalted butter
1 large onion, cut into 1/2-inch dice
1 small fennel bulb-halved, cored and cut into 1/2-inch dice
One 1 1/2-inch piece of fresh ginger, peeled and finely chopped
6 cups chicken stock
One 14-ounce can of unsweetened coconut milk
3/4 cup chilled heavy cream
1 teaspoon hazelnut oil
1/8 teaspoon cayenne pepper
Kosher salt
1 1/2 tablespoons fresh lemon juice

Steps:

  • Preheat the oven to 350°. Rub the cut sides of the squash with the olive oil and set them, cut side down, on a large rimmed baking sheet. Bake the squash for about 1 hour, or until very tender. Remove from the oven and let stand until cool enough to handle. Spoon the squash flesh into a large bowl; discard the skins. In a pie plate, toast the pecans for about 8 minutes, or until lightly browned and fragrant; let the nuts cool. In a large pot, melt the butter. Add the onion, fennel and ginger and cook over moderate heat until softened, about 8 minutes. Add the squash and the chicken stock, cover and simmer for 20 minutes, stirring occasionally. Uncover the pot and continue cooking until the squash starts to fall apart, about 10 minutes. Remove from the heat and stir in the coconut milk. Meanwhile, in a food processor, pulse the pecans until they are finely chopped. In a medium bowl, beat the cream until soft peaks form. Fold in the chopped pecans, hazelnut oil and cayenne pepper and season with salt. Working in batches, puree the squash soup in a blender until smooth. Stir in the lemon juice and season with salt. Ladle the soup into bowls, top with a dollop of the pecan cream and serve. MAKE AHEAD The soup can be refrigerated for up to 2 days. Reheat gently, adding a little chicken stock to thin the soup.

SPICY BUTTERNUT SQUASH SOUP



Spicy Butternut Squash Soup image

I perused multiple recipes for a winter squash soup to make for Thanksgiving this year... and I ended up coming up with my own version. I made mine quite spicy, though, of course the heat can be toned down for those who can't tolerate it. Either way, the flavor is wonderful and the heartiness of the soup is very satisfying.

Time 3h

Number Of Ingredients 12

2 large fresh butternut squash
1 large yellow onion
3 large celery stalks, diced
2 large carrots, diced
2 Tbsp fresh garlic, finely chopped
2-3 Tbsp unsalted butter
2 Tbsp olive oil, extra virgin
2-3 box low sodium chicken stock
1 Tbsp fresh thyme, finely chopped
1 can(s) (or less, to taste) chipotle chiles in adobo sauce
sea salt and freshly ground black pepper, to taste
crumbled goat cheese

Steps:

  • 1. Preheat oven to 400 degrees. Prepare shallow baking pan by covering w/ foil. Split the squash lengthwise, scrape out the seeds and strings, rub olive oil on the "meat" side of the squash and place face down on the foil. Poke some holes in the skin w/ a fork. Bake 45 min. to 1 hour, until tender. Allow to cool, then use an ice cream scoop to scoop out the meat of the squash into a bowl and set aside.
  • 2. Sauté onion, celery and carrots in unsalted butter and/or olive oil until just becoming soft, add garlic and sauté a few minutes more
  • 3. Use a potato masher on the squash, add to soup pot, add chicken stock to desired thickness, and fresh thyme. Bring to a simmer, add desired amount of chiles in adobo sauce and allow to simmer until everything is soft. I added one entire can of the chiles, left chiles whole and then pulled them out once they had plumped up and released their flavor. This left the soup quite spicy.
  • 4. Use immersion blender to make a smooth consistency, or blend in standard blender in batches. Season w/ sea salt and freshly ground black pepper to taste.
  • 5. Garnish w/ crumbled goat cheese to provide the perfect counterbalance for the heat.
